业界专家解读静态存储的最新进展:存储技术前沿动态,把握行业趋势
发布时间: 2024-08-25 18:16:26 阅读量: 23 订阅数: 19
![静态存储的基本概念与应用实战](https://pic2.pedaily.cn/23/202309/20239181649322395.jpg)
# 1. 静态存储技术概述
静态存储技术是一种非易失性存储技术,其数据在断电后仍能保持不变。与动态存储技术(如DRAM)相比,静态存储技术具有访问延迟低、功耗低、可靠性高的优点。
静态存储技术广泛应用于各种场景,包括高性能计算、人工智能、机器学习、边缘计算和物联网。在这些场景中,静态存储技术可以提供高性能、低功耗和高可靠性的存储解决方案。
# 2. 静态存储技术原理与架构
### 2.1 静态存储器件类型及特性
静态存储器件是静态存储技术的基础,其主要类型包括:
- **SRAM (Static Random Access Memory)**:SRAM 采用双稳态存储单元,每个单元由两个互补的晶体管组成。数据以电荷的形式存储在晶体管的栅极上,无需刷新操作即可保持数据。SRAM 具有极快的读写速度和低功耗,但其存储密度较低。
- **DRAM (Dynamic Random Access Memory)**:DRAM 采用单稳态存储单元,每个单元由一个电容和一个晶体管组成。数据以电荷的形式存储在电容上,但电容会随着时间的推移而放电,因此需要定期刷新操作以保持数据。DRAM 具有较高的存储密度和较低的成本,但其读写速度和功耗高于 SRAM。
- **MRAM (Magnetoresistive Random Access Memory)**:MRAM 采用磁性材料存储数据,数据以磁化方向的形式存储。MRAM 具有非易失性、高耐用性和低功耗,但其存储密度和读写速度低于 SRAM 和 DRAM。
- **RRAM (Resistive Random Access Memory)**:RRAM 采用电阻材料存储数据,数据以电阻值的形式存储。RRAM 具有非易失性、高存储密度和低功耗,但其读写速度和耐用性低于 SRAM 和 DRAM。
### 2.2 静态存储器阵列设计与管理
静态存储器阵列是静态存储器件的集合,其设计和管理对于提高存储性能和可靠性至关重要。
**存储器阵列设计**
- **存储单元组织**:存储单元可以按行、列或块组织。不同的组织方式会影响存储器的访问速度和容量。
- **冗余管理**:冗余技术可以提高存储器阵列的可靠性。冗余可以包括备用行、备用列和纠错码 (ECC)。
- **存储器接口**:存储器接口定义了存储器与其他组件之间的通信协议。常见的存储器接口包括 DDR、LPDDR 和 HBM。
**存储器阵列管理**
- **刷新操作**:DRAM 存储单元需要定期刷新以保持数据。刷新操作可以按行、按列或按块进行。
- **错误检测和纠正**:ECC 技术可以检测和纠正存储器阵列中的错误。ECC 可以通过硬件或软件实现。
- **电源管理**:电源管理技术可以降低存储器阵列的功耗。电源管理技术包括时钟门控、电压调节和休眠模式。
### 2.3 静态存储器访问机制与协议
静态存储器访问机制和协议定义了如何访问和操作存储器阵列。
**访问机制**
- **读操作**:读操作从存储器阵列中读取数据。读操作可以按字节、字或块进行。
- **写操作**:写操作将数据写入存储器阵列。写操作可以按字节、字或块进行。
- **修改操作**:修改操作修改存储器阵列中的数据,而不替换整个数据块。修改操作可以按位或按字节进行。
**协议**
- **存储器总线协议**:存储器总线协议定义了存储器与其他组件之间的通信规则。常见的存储器总线协议包括 PCI Express 和 AMBA。
- **缓存一致性协议**:缓存一致性协议确保多个缓存中的数据保持一致。常见的缓存一致性协议包括 MESI 和 MOESI。
- **事务处理协议**:事务处理协议确保存储器操作的原子性和一致性。常见的事务处理协议包括 ACID 和 CAP。
# 3. 静态存储技术应用场景
静态存储技术凭借其低延迟、高带宽和高可靠性的特点,在以下应用场景中发挥着至关重要的作用:
### 3.1 高性能计算与数据中心
在高性能计算(HPC)和数据中心领域,静态存储技术为大规模并行计算和数据密集型应用提供了理想的存储解决方案。静态存储器的低延
0
0